		<description>As you may know, cheese may actually be physically addictive to some people. The protein casein, found in dairy products, contains casiomorphins, an opiate-like product that helps induce calves to drink their mothers&#039; milk. It affects different people in different degrees. Since a lot of the moisture is drained out of cheese, this addictive substance is more concentrated in that food product.

What I&#039;ve found over the last several years is that with the majority of people who give up cheese, the craving for it drops dramatically within about six months.

Also, dairy is produced by forcibly impregnating cows (so they&#039;ll continually produce milk), taking their babies from them (so we can have the milk), and killing them, even if pregnant with calf, when they&#039;re about five years old. Cruel and nasty.

I agree - fat tastes good and is satisfying. (I also agree that a fixation with numbers tends not to work as a long-tern solution.) For a fat-tasting cheeseless pizza, I use some olive oil on the crust, and I add toppings such as olives, pine nuts, and artichoke hearts, which produce a fatty, filling sensation. Also, the vegan parmesans, typically made from nutritional yeast and/or nuts, are great substitutes for sprinkled dairy parmesan.
